SonicWALL, Inc.
DISTRIBUTION AGREEMENT
SonicWALL, Inc. ("SonicWALL") and Alternative Technology, Inc. ("Distributor") agree to the terms and conditions of this Distribution Agreement ("Agreement"). The Agreement authorizes Distributor to acquire Products from SonicWALL, identified in the then-current SonicWALL Price List, and market them directly to Resellers.
SonicWALL manufactures and sells Products, some of which may include third party products licensed to SonicWALL.
1. DEFINITIONS
a. | "Distributor" is a business entity which markets and distributes Products acquired directly from SonicWALL. |
b. | "Defined Area" means countries listed in attachment A, and shall further specifically exclude any countries prohibited by U.S. Government restrictions. |
c. | "Products" mean the current and future versions of SonicWALL's products as identified in the then-current edition of the SonicWALL Price List, which is hereby incorporated into this Agreement by reference that are made available to Distributor under the terms and conditions of this Agreement. Products covered by this agreement are listed in attachment A. |
d. | "Point of Sale Report" means a report provided by Distributor to SonicWALL which is in a SonicWALL approved format, and which includes, (i) the submitter name. (ii) the "ship to" destination zip code, other applicable postal identification code and "ship to" company name, (iii) the part number (iv) the quantity sold and (v) the date sold, (vi) the current inventory on hand and backlog by part number. |
e. | "Agreement" is used to describe this set of covenants, promises, understandings, obligations, price lists, and other named documents, as may be added from time to time. |
f. | "Confidential Information" means the information and materials which are marked by SonicWALL or orally described as confidential or proprietary, and any trade secrets or know-how disclosed to the Distributor as a result of and under the terms and conditions of this Agreement. |
2. APPOINTMENT. Distributor shall have the non-exclusive right to purchase the Products identified in Attachment A for marketing and resale to resellers within the Defined Area.
3. TERM OF AGREEMENT. This term of this Agreement is for a period of one (1) year, unless terminated earlier as provided in the Agreement, and will commence on the date it is executed by an authorized SonicWALL signatory and will automatically renew in twelve (12) month increments. The acceptance of any purchase order by SonicWALL after the termination date will be construed as extending the Agreement on a month-to month basis, with month-to-month Agreement subject to termination at any time by either party upon thirty (30) days' prior written notice.
4. PRODUCTS AND PRICES
1
a. | Eligible Products. Distributor may market the Products identified in Attachment A. SonicWALL reserves the right at any time to make changes or modifications to any Products, including those which are required (i) for security, or (ii) to facilitate performance in accordance with specifications. |
b. | Prices. The prices at which Distributor may acquire the Products are listed on the appropriate and then-current SonicWALL price list, which may be subject to discount as per Attachment A. SonicWALL reserves the right to add or withdraw Products from its price lists. Price changes will become effective thirty (30) days after being issued, or will become effective as indicated on the notification of price change. Orders requesting delivery after the effective date of a price increase will be charged at the increased price. In the event of a price decrease, all inventory acquired by Distributor from SonicWALL before the price decrease and not yet sold or under a contract for sale will be granted price protection. The difference between the price existing immediately prior to the decrease, less any prior credits, and the new price will be credited to Distributor account. Price protection will not be granted in the case of a temporary price decrease or a special promotion. |
c. | Taxes. Prices are exclusive of all applicable taxes. Distributor agrees to pay all taxes associated with the marketing, sublicensing and delivery of the Products ordered, including but not limited to sales, use, excise, added value and similar taxes and all customs, duties or governmental impositions, but excluding taxes on SonicWALL's net income. |

6. MARKET DEVELOPMENT FUNDS (MDF)
SONICWALL shall provide Market Development Funds ("MDF") equal to 3% of Distributor's net purchases from SONICWALL. The amount of MDF available shall be calculated on a quarterly basis and can be used for marketing activities in the Defined Area by the Distributor. Distributor must get written approval from SONICWALL for any marketing activity expenditure, which will be paid for with MDF. Payment with MDF by SONICWALL to Distributor shall be in a form of a credit note applied to Preferred Partner's account. MDF accrued in one calendar quarter must be used within 1 year of the end of the quarter in which it was earned; any remaining MDF shall expire thereafter.
7. PLACING ORDERS &TERMS OF PAYMENT
a. | Financial Information & Credit. At SonicWALL's request, Distributor agrees to provide such information and evidence of financial security as reasonably required by SonicWALL for the purpose of the Distributor's establishing and/or maintaining an open account with SonicWALL. SonicWALL reserves the right to require, as a condition for accepting any order or shipping any Product to Distributor, prepayment or a letter of credit or similar instrument confirming by such bank or other institution as SonicWALL, in its sole discretion, may deem acceptable to assure payment on behalf of Distributor. SonicWALL reserves the right to set the credit limit at any level deemed prudent and may increase or decrease the line of credit at any time, at its sole discretion. Payment terms are NET 30 days from date of invoice, in U.S.Dollars. Invoices not paid when due shall accrue interest, at the rate of 1.5% per month or the maximum rate allowed by law, whichever is less. All Products ordered in excess of the credit limit shall be paid for in a method acceptable to SonicWALL in advance of shipment. Repeated or persistent late payments are sufficient cause for: (1) forfeiture of any discounts earned or granted under this agreement; (2) the revocation of credit terms with SonicWALL; (3) termination of this agreement between the distributor and SonicWALL, such action being solely the right of SonicWALL; (4) or any combination of the foregoing, as SonicWALL sees fit to apply or exercise. |

8. RETURNS
4
a. | Defective Products/Dead on Arrival (DOA). Distributor shall have the right to return to SONICWALL for Return Credit any DOA product that is returned to Distributor within thirty (30) days after the initial delivery date to Distributor's customer. Distributor shall bear all costs of shipping and risk of loss of DOA and in-warranty products to SONICWALL's location. |
b. | Obsolete or Outdated Product. Distributor shall have the right to return the Return Credit all products that become obsolete that have been in Distributor's inventory for less than 90 days. Distributor shall bear all costs of shipping and risk of loss products to SONICWALL's location. |
c. | Stock Balance. Distributor may return overstocked inventory once per quarter. Returns must be no greater than 10% of the net quarterly purchases for the preceding quarter. Products returned must be unused, undamaged, sealed in their original packages and in merchantable condition. An offsetting Purchaser Order must accompany the Stock Balance Return request. Distributor shall bear all costs of shipping and risk of loss of products returned to SONICWALL’s location. |
d. | Return Materials Authorization (RMA) Number. Distributor must request and obtain an RMA number from SONICWALL before returning any product. Any product received by SONICWALL without an RMA number shall be returned to Distributor at Distributor's cost. |

13. DEFAULT/TERMINATION
7
a. | Default. In addition to any other rights or remedies which may be available at law or in equity, either party may terminate this Agreement upon an event of default by the other party. Events of default include: (i) if either party fails to observe any term or condition under this Agreement and such failure continues for thirty (30) days following receipt of written notice from the other party; (ii) If Distributor is acquired by or comes under the control of different ownership, is dissolved, or is involved in a reorganization; (iii) If Distributor is not paying its debts as they become due, becomes insolvent, files or has filed against it a petition (or other document) under any Bankruptcy Law or similar law, makes a general assignment or trust mortgage for the benefit of creditors, or if a receiver, trustee, custodian or similar agent is appointed or takes possession of any of Distributor's property or business. |
b. | Termination for Convenience. Either party may terminate this Agreement solely for convenience upon thirty (30) days prior written notice. |
c. | Effect of Termination on Obligations. Termination of this Agreement shall not affect any pre-termination obligations of either party under this Agreement and any such termination is without prejudice to the enforcement of any undischarged obligations existing at the time of termination. Notwithstanding the above, in the event SonicWALL terminates this Agreement for default all charges accrued by Distributor will become immediately due and payable. Regardless of any other provision of this Agreement, SonicWALL will not by reason of the termination of this Agreement be liable for compensation, reimbursement, or damages on account of the loss of prospective profits on anticipated sales, or on account of expenditures, investments, leases, or commitments in connection with Distributor's business or goodwill, or otherwise. |
